BTU per Hour (Thermochemical)
Introduction : The thermochemical BTU per hour is a variation of BTU/h based on the thermochemical definition of BTU (1 BTU = 1054.35 J). It accounts for energy changes in chemical processes.
History & Origin : Created for consistency in chemistry and fuel analysis, this unit reflects the precise energy required to raise water temperature under specific conditions. It became essential in scientific calorimetry.
Current Use : Used in fuel combustion analysis, calorimetry, and thermodynamic research. Common in laboratories and industries dealing with fuel efficiency, chemical engineering, and energy audits.

What is the process of conversion from attojoule second to btu th hour units?
For conversion from attojoule second to btu th hour, multiply the number of attojoule second by 3.4144259496372E-18 as one attojoule second equals 3.4144259496372E-18 btu th hour.
Formula: No of btu th hour = No of attojoule second × 3.4144259496372E-18
This is the standard method used for conversion between these units of power.
How do you convert btu th hour to attojoule second?
To convert btu th hour to attojoule second, multiply the number of btu th hour by 2.92875E+17 as one btu th hour equals 2.92875E+17 attojoule second.
Formula: No of attojoule second = No of btu th hour × 2.92875E+17
